I am using Quartus II 11.0. It looks like the FIR filter Megafunction supports only Signed Binary or Signed Fractional Binary.
As far as I understand, this means that the MSB is the sign bit, and the lower order bits are the magnitude. Is that correct? Why isn't there a twos-complement option? Does it make the FIR implementation easier? http://i.imgur.com/VD6X8.pngLink Copied

--- Quote Start --- Why isn't there a twos-complement option? --- Quote End --- Both are 2's compliment. Signed fractional binary format results in the same hardware implementation as signed binary format, the binary point is conceptual only. Its quite possible the GUI displays things differently, or the coefficients can be passed in as fractional integers represented as what appear to be floating point values in a text file, but ultimately the hardware will look the same. Cheers, Dave

Sign-magnitude is a rather inpracticable numeric format and not used by any Altera IP, as far I'm aware of. It's only an option when displaying numeric vaues in SignalTap and other tools.
